This month - All remote jobs
  • Logikcull
    Must be located: United States of America or North America.

    What we need:

    Logikcull’s team is seeking a Senior Software Developer who is sharp, motivated and will help build the technology backbone of Logikcull. This team is responsible for the end-to-end technology needs for authentication and authorization services, account management, user management, and support for internal data warehousing and analytics. We use technologies like Ruby on Rails, NodeJS, Serverless, AWS Kinesis, AWS DynamoDB, AWS Lambda.

    What you'll be doing:

    • Implementing the best engineering practices to write well constructed and easy to maintain code and write defensive and robust tests
    • Design well-architected solutions and build iteratively into systems while maintaining the best agile practices
    • Communicate status with peers, managers and other stakeholders and present views and opinions respectfully
    • Help us onboard new developers
    • Participating in our agile methodology (Daily Standups, Sprint Planning, Maintenance, Backlog Grooming, Retrospectives)
    • Design and drive the future of our microservices strategies
    • Feature specification, planning, and development
    • Assist with Services and API DocumentationHelp with bug fixes & participate on an on-call rotation
    • Conduct performance monitoring on our system to ensure quality

    What we need from you:

    • A Bachelor’s degree in Computer Science or equivalent experience
    • 5+ years of top-tier software development experience
    • Proficiency in Ruby, Python, NodeJS or Java (JVM)
    • Expertise with core Computer Science fundamentals, including Object-Oriented programming, data structures and algorithms (hashing, trees, graphs, search etc)
    • Strong functional programming experience
    • Fundamental understanding of relational databases
    • Enjoys going deep on performance tuning
    • Love owning a problem end to end
    • Relentless pursuer of better ways to solve problems and improve systems
    • Knack for designing large scale distributed systems
    • Logikcull’s mission and values inspire you to want to do your best work
Older - All remote jobs
  • Logikcull
    PROBABLY NO LONGER AVAILABLE.Must be located: United States of America.

    What we need:

    We are looking for a talented and passionate front end engineer to help us continue to provide our customers with a powerfully simple user experience. You should be experienced with Javascript, (semantic) HTML, and (maintainable) CSS and enjoy using them to build user interfaces that solve real problems for customers. Experience with one or more Javascript frameworks like React or Angular is helpful, but what we’re really looking for is an understanding and appreciation of plain ol’ vanilla JS. You won’t be a team of one though — you’ll be collaborating closely with other front-end engineers and our Product team (product designers and product managers) to build prototypes, and with our full stack engineers to plan and build features. We are looking for someone who is looking to make a big impact and is just as happy working in a team as they are independently.

    What you'll be doing:

    • Writing front end application code for new feature development
    • Contributing to the development of the next version of our front-end architecture
    • Participating in the agile rhythm meetings of a cross functional squad
    • Creating modular UI components for our new design system
    • Listening to customers and observing them using our software
    • Prototyping new features and iterating on them to ensure we push the best features that we can
    • Writing tests to ensure high code quality
    • Being a champion of accessibility and site performance

    What we need from you:

    • 3+ years of experience working in as a Frontend Engineer or comparable role
    • Expertise in Vanilla JavaScript. You understand it’s pros, cons and how to optimize for what you’re building
    • Expertise in Modular CSS
    • Expertise Semantic HTML
    • A commitment to optimizing for performance. You take pride in knowing the application you’re working on is efficient, fast and functional for its users.
    • A love of teamwork and collaboration. You enjoy working with, learning from and helping others in your job.
    • A strong internal motivation. You are passionate about the work your do and able to keep yourself motivated, even when times get tough.
    • A desire to learn. You’re always on a quest to learn a new approach to something and implement it into your workflow if possible
    • An understanding UI/UX Design best practices.
    • A familiarity with ES6, Ruby, Backbone, Marionette, React and Typescript